Troubleshooting Trailer Brakes That One Wheel Locks Up When Braking
Updated 01/17/2017 | Published 01/16/2017 >
Question:
I have a 2003 12 foot haulmark twin axle enclosed trailer. All brake shoes were replaced recently, now the right rear tire nearly locks up when brakes are applied. My question is, on the right side when replacing shoes, does the primary shoe one with longest brake pad go to the front or the rear. All four brake assemblies were adjusted the same.
asked by: Carroll B
Expert Reply:
The shorter brake shoe should always be facing the front of the trailer. As well as the "C" shaped arm on the inside of the assembly. See the diagram that shows the different sized shoes and the arm.
If the brake is installed correctly I would check the adjustment just to be sure before anything else. The next step will be to inspect the wiring for any pinches or damaged points. There could be a short on the circuit.
